Definition of Amazon Virtual Private Cloud
Amazon Virtual Private Cloud (Amazon VPC) is a cloud computing service offered by Amazon Web Services (AWS) that allows users to create their own isolated virtual networks within the AWS infrastructure. By using VPC, customers can customize their network configurations, including IP address range, subnets, and security settings, to support their specific applications and requirements. This enables a secure, scalable, and customizable environment for deploying and managing cloud-based resources.
The phonetic pronunciation of the keyword “Amazon Virtual Private Cloud” would be:AM-uh-zahn vur-choo-uhl PRIV-uht kloud
- Amazon Virtual Private Cloud (VPC) allows you to create and manage an isolated, customizable, and secure virtual network within the AWS Cloud for your resources.
- VPC provides advanced security features, such as security groups and network access control lists, which help control access to your resources and protect them from unauthorized users.
- With Amazon VPC, you have the flexibility to choose the IP address range, create subnets, configure routing tables, and set up virtual private gateways and VPN connections for seamless integration with your on-premises networks.
Importance of Amazon Virtual Private Cloud
Amazon Virtual Private Cloud (VPC) is an essential technology term because it refers to a secure, scalable, and customizable cloud computing solution offered by Amazon Web Services (AWS). VPC enables organizations to create an isolated virtual network within the AWS ecosystem, giving them full control over their cloud resources, including IP address range, subnets, and route tables.
This configuration optimizes security, privacy, and network performance.
By leveraging Amazon VPC, businesses can efficiently manage diverse workloads, run applications with advanced security features, and seamlessly integrate with on-premises systems.
The flexibility, control, and enhanced security offered by Amazon VPC make it a critical component for companies embracing cloud technology to support their growth and digital transformation efforts.
Amazon Virtual Private Cloud (Amazon VPC) is a pivotal cloud technology that seeks to provide organizations with a secure, virtualized private network infrastructure within the Amazon Web Services (AWS) cloud environment. The primary purpose of Amazon VPC is to empower businesses to enjoy the benefits of the cloud while maintaining a secure network perimeter, equivalent to that of an on-premises data center, ensuring the utmost privacy and control over their resources.
By utilizing the Amazon VPC, customers can provision logically isolated sections of the AWS cloud, configured with customizable IP address ranges, subnets, and security groups to achieve a seamless extension of their existing network. Moreover, Amazon VPC plays a significant role in enabling organizations to run and manage a wide array of cloud-based applications, workloads, and services tailored to their specific needs.
This allows businesses to optimize cost efficiency, enhance scalability, and have greater control over critical operational aspects such as traffic routing, access management, and resource allocation. Additionally, VPC offers a range of connectivity options, including the ability to establish secure Virtual Private Network (VPN) connections between a company’s on-premises infrastructure and their cloud environment, further reinforcing the organization’s security posture.
In summary, Amazon VPC offers a robust and feature-rich platform that simplifies the process of deploying and managing secure, scalable, and cost-effective cloud solutions for businesses of all sizes.
Examples of Amazon Virtual Private Cloud
Amazon Virtual Private Cloud (VPC) is a cloud service that provides a secure, customizable, and scalable virtual network environment for users to deploy and run various applications and services. Here are three real-world examples of how organizations use Amazon VPC:
Financial Institutions:Many financial institutions, such as banks, insurance companies, and fintech firms, opt for Amazon VPC to isolate their applications and data into separate secure environments. They use VPC to handle sensitive data, meet regulatory compliance requirements, and ensure high levels of security. For example, Capital One, a leading US-based bank, has adopted Amazon VPC to build a secure, scalable, and resilient infrastructure for running their applications and services.
Healthcare Organizations:Healthcare organizations use Amazon VPC to maintain the security and privacy of their user’s personal health information (PHI). By leveraging features like Virtual Private Network (VPN) connections and access control lists (ACLs), healthcare providers can create a secure, HIPAA-compliant environment to store and manage sensitive data. For instance, Philips HealthSuite, a cloud-based health IT system, uses Amazon VPC to securely manage healthcare applications and protect patient data.
Media & Entertainment Companies:Organizations in the media and entertainment industry, such as streaming services, digital media platforms, and gaming companies, use Amazon VPC to ensure reliable and secure content delivery. These companies use VPC’s scalability and flexibility to manage peaks in demand or to deliver high-quality content worldwide without compromising security. For example, Netflix, a leading streaming service provider, relies on Amazon VPC to create separate environments for content delivery and securely isolating development, testing, and production environments.
Amazon Virtual Private Cloud FAQ
What is Amazon Virtual Private Cloud (VPC)?
Amazon Virtual Private Cloud (VPC) is a service that provides users the ability to create private virtual networks within the Amazon Web Services (AWS) cloud infrastructure. It allows users to define their own IP address space, create subnets, configure routing tables, and network gateways for full control over their virtual networking environment.
How does Amazon VPC work?
Amazon VPC works by allowing users to create a logically isolated network within AWS infrastructure. Users define their own IP address space, create subnets, launch Amazon Elastic Compute Cloud (EC2) instances, configure routing rules and access control lists, and create virtual private gateways and VPN connections to connect their VPC with on-premises networks or other VPCs.
What are the benefits of using Amazon VPC?
Amazon VPC provides enhanced security, flexibility, and control over your cloud infrastructure. Key benefits include the ability to define your IP address space, increased isolation between resources, secure connections between VPCs and on-premises networks, simplified network management, and easy scalability of resources within your VPC.
How do I get started with Amazon VPC?
To get started with Amazon VPC, sign in to the AWS Management Console, navigate to the VPC dashboard, and create a new VPC. Then, configure subnets, security groups, and routing tables, and launch your desired AWS resources within your VPC. Getting started guides and documentation are available on the AWS website to assist with the setup process.
What is the cost of using Amazon VPC?
There are no additional charges for creating and using a VPC. However, standard rates apply for data transfer, Amazon EC2 instances, and other AWS resources used within your VPC. For more information on Amazon VPC pricing, visit the AWS VPC pricing page.
Related Technology Terms
- VPC (Virtual Private Cloud)
- Security Groups
- Network ACLs (Access Control Lists)
- VPN (Virtual Private Network) Connections
Sources for More Information
- Amazon Web Services: https://aws.amazon.com/vpc/
- Amazon Web Services Documentation: https://docs.aws.amazon.com/vpc/latest/userguide/what-is-amazon-vpc.html
- Amazon Web Services Official YouTube Channel: https://www.youtube.com/playlist?list=PLhr1KZpdzukcG0_gH_2mlbIoOL3g5UAn3
- A Cloud Guru: https://acloudguru.com/course/aws-certified-solutions-architect-associate-saa-c02?vpc